Sturdy
DescriptiveMeaning
Strong, robust, or hardy in character or physique.
Etymology
From Old French 'esturdi' meaning stunned or dazed, later evolving to mean strong or sturdy. The surname originated as a descriptive epithet for a strong or resilient person.
About the Sturdy Surname
Sturdy is an English descriptive surname indicating strength or robustness. The name has been used consistently throughout English history.
Distribution
Found throughout England and English-speaking countries, with moderate frequency.
